UFC 264 left some unanswered questions but what we did learn is Dustin Poirier is a dead set superstar. 'The Diamond' scored a second straight victory over the Irishman and even with an unsatisfactory finish, there is no denying Poirier is one of the greatest lightweight in history. This week, we unwrap UFC 264 and discuss what's next for the two lightweight kingpins. Also Tai Tuivasa may have been the biggest winner from UFC 264 with a standout performance from his walkout, to the fight to his post fight shoey. Ands Joseph Parker clears up the rumors surrounding his apparent COVID-19 diagnosis ---- or lack thereof. See omnystudio.com/listener for privacy information.
